When I click on the power button on the panel of the DTX500 there is a slight burst of light/power but there are no other indicators on the display screen. I did try to reset but nothing happens when I press down both arrow keys and then the power button. Please let me know if there are any other possible solutions.

The Yamaha DTX500 manual provides troubleshooting steps for issues related to power and display. Here are possible steps to check:

1. Ensure the power cable and adapter are properly connected.
2. Verify that the power adapter matches the required specifications.
3. Check for any visible damage on the power cable or adapter.
4. Try using a different power outlet.
5. If the issue persists, contact a Yamaha Service Center or the dealer for further assistance.

If the device shows a slight burst of light but no display indicators, it may indicate a power or internal component issue requiring professional inspection.
